Welcome to Mine KilI State Park Disc Golf Course located in North Blenheim NY.

Located on a beautiful and well manicured property, situated within the scenic Schoharie Valley, and just minutes from the Mine KilI Falls, Mine KilI State Park Disc Golf Course has mulitple layouts including the Mine KilI Disc Golf Championship Orange layout that we are looking at today, a par 63, 7,802 foot layout with 24 floors of elevation change.

This course begins with challenging open holes on the front 9, and nearing extreme elevation change wooded holes on the back 9.

Brushed cement tee pads as well as tee signs for both orange and green tees, are a testament to the work that the local community and parks department has put into this course. Targets are Orange Mach V's.

No fee to enter the park or to play, and the park has disc rentals for $1!

Dog and cart friendly, restrooms are available most of the year.
